/skills-installer [action] [skill-name]About this resource
The /skills-installer command installs Agent Skills - model-controlled configuration packages that extend Claude's capabilities with specialized domain knowledge.
Features
- 47 Specialized Skills: Domain-specific expertise packages
- Progressive Disclosure: Skills activate only when relevant to task
- Plugin System: Modular knowledge packages
- Auto-Activation: Claude automatically selects appropriate skills
- Skill Discovery: Browse available skills by category
- Version Management: Update skills as they evolve
- Dependency Resolution: Auto-install required dependencies
- Team Sharing: Commit skills config to git
Usage
/skills-installer [action] [skill-name]
Actions
--install- Install skill by name--list- List available skills--installed- Show installed skills--uninstall- Remove skill--update- Update installed skills--search- Search skills by keyword
Categories
--development- Programming and development skills--devops- Infrastructure and deployment--data- Data science and analytics--security- Security and compliance--frontend- UI/UX and frontend--backend- Server-side and APIs
What Are Agent Skills?
Agent Skills are model-controlled configurations that give Claude specialized knowledge:
- Files, scripts, resources for specific domains
- Activated automatically when relevant
- Extend capabilities without manual prompting
- Similar to VS Code extensions but for AI

Progressive Disclosure
How Skills Activate
User: "Fix the login component"
[Skill Selection Process]
1. Detect context: React component
2. Check installed skills
3. Activate: react-19-expert
4. Load knowledge: React 19 patterns
5. Apply to task
Claude: *Uses React 19 patterns automatically*
Multiple Skills Simultaneously
User: "Optimize the database queries in the API"
[Skills Activated]
✓ prisma-advanced (database queries)
✓ node-20-performance (API optimization)
✓ typescript-strict (type safety)
Claude: *Combines knowledge from all 3 skills*
Skill Configuration
Where Skills Are Stored
# Project skills (team-shared)
.claude/
skills/
react-19-expert/
config.json
patterns.md
examples/
typescript-strict/
config.json
rules.md
# User skills (personal)
~/.claude/
skills/
personal-shortcuts/
Skill Configuration File
// .claude/skills/react-19-expert/config.json
{
"name": "react-19-expert",
"version": "1.2.0",
"description": "React 19 expert with latest features",
"activationTriggers": [
{ "filePattern": "**/*.{tsx,jsx}" },
{ "keyword": "react" },
{ "packageJson": "react" }
],
"capabilities": [
"React 19.1 features",
"Server Components",
"React Compiler",
"New hooks"
],
"dependencies": ["typescript-strict"]
}

Best Practices
Install Relevant Skills Only
# ✅ Good: Install skills you actually use
/skills-installer --install react-19-expert typescript-strict
# ❌ Bad: Install everything
/skills-installer --install * # Don't do this
Team Collaboration
# Commit skills config to git
git add .claude/skills/
git commit -m "Add React 19 and TypeScript skills"
# Team members get same skills automatically
git pull
# Skills auto-install on first use
Skill Priority
// More specific skills override general skills
{
"skills": [
{ "name": "typescript-strict", "priority": 10 },
{ "name": "react-19-expert", "priority": 20 }, // Higher priority
{ "name": "next-15-expert", "priority": 30 } // Highest priority
]
}
Troubleshooting
Skill Not Activating
# Check skill installation
/skills-installer --installed
# Verify activation triggers
# Edit .claude/skills/[skill]/config.json
# Manually activate for testing
"Use the React 19 expert skill for this task"
Conflicting Skills
# Some skills may conflict
# Example: jest-expert + vitest-expert
# Solution: Uninstall conflicting skill
/skills-installer --uninstall jest-expert
Skill Updates Breaking
# Rollback to previous version
/skills-installer --rollback react-19-expert
# Or pin specific version
/skills-installer --install react-19-expert@1.2.0
